1、首先需要安装python和flask,这个是必须的嘛。 2、我们这里实现的是一个POST功能的简单接口。 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 fromflaskimportFlask, request, jsonify importjson app=Flask(__name__) app.debug=True @app.
# method必须设置为post. # enctype必须设置为multipart/form-data不然游览器根本不会发送文件 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 状态保持 @app.route('/') def set_cookie(): # make_response自定义响应的类容 resp = make_response('我设置了一个...
首先,我们需要安装 Flask。打开终端或命令提示符,运行下面的命令: pipinstallflask 1. 创建Flask 应用 接下来,我们可以开始编写代码了。首先,创建一个 Python 文件,例如app.py。在该文件中导入 Flask,并初始化一个 Flask 应用: fromflaskimportFlask app=Flask(__name__) 1. 2. 3. 定义接收 POST 请求的路由...
pip install Flask 使用python实现POST接口 fromflaskimportFlask, request, jsonify app= Flask(__name__) @app.route('/test', methods=['POST'])defsubmit():#获取 JSON 请求体data =request.get_json()#从请求体中提取参数name = data.get('name') uuid= data.get('uuid')#打印参数print(f"Name: ...
app = Flask(__name__) @app.route('/submit', methods=['GET', 'POST']) def submit(): if request.method == 'POST': # 处理POST请求的逻辑 # ... # 生成GET请求的URL,并重定向到该URL return redirect(url_for('success')) else: ...
httpflaskxmljsonphp 前言 在 Flask 中 由全局对象 request 来提供请求信息。 Request 请求对象首先,您必须从 flask 模块导入请求对象: from flask import request 通过使用 method 属性可以操作当前请求方法,通过使用 form 属性处理表单数据(在 POST 或者 PUT 请求 中传输的数据)。以下是使用上述两个属性的例子: fr...
用户 密码
请求行的 method 不同; POST 可以附加 body,可以支持 form、json、xml、binary等各种数据格式; 从行业通用规范的角度来说,无状态变化的建议使用 GET 请求,数据的写入与状态建议用 POST 请求; 演示环境搭建 为了避免其他因素的干扰,使用 Flask 编写一个简单的 Demo Server。 安装flask pip install flask 创建一个...
(): if request.method == 'POST': if request.form['username'] == 'admin': return redirect(url_for('success')) else: abort(401) else: return redirect(url_for('index'))@app.route('/success', methods = ['POST', 'GET'])def success(): return 'logged in successfully'if __name__...
我正在做的是:我在 JS(客户端)中生成一个 csv 文件,然后将它发送到烧瓶,然后我使用 python 脚本过滤文件,然后将其返回给客户端。除了最后一部分,一切都很好。当涉及到返回 render_template 时,它只是跳过那部分。这很奇怪,因为它在if request.method == 'POST' 内部。我在if request.method=='POST' 中打印...